Needham & Company maintains a 'Hold' on FuelCell Energy (NASDAQ: FCEL).

Needham analyst says, "FuelCell Energy is making progress towards ‘breakeven’ operating levels, in our opinion. We believe visibility is improving as the recent results highlight a growing backlog due to the large POSCO Power order with annual production rate increased by 60% annually. In addition, the product cost structure modesty improved (excluding a one-time charge). Maintain Hold rating, as we would like to see a more orders booked before becoming potentially more positive on FCEL shares."
